Aortic stenosis impacts millions of people globally, yet it often remains under-diagnosed and under-treated. Edwards’ groundbreaking work in transcatheter aortic heart valve replacement (TAVR) pioneered an innovative, life-changing solution for patients by offering heart valve replacement without the need for open heart surgery. Our Transcatheter Heart Valve (THV) business unit continues to partner with cardiologists and clinical teams to transform patient care with devices supported by clinical evidence. You will apply your knowledge of quality engineering principles and methods to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and Edwards' systems/procedures to optimize product development, internal and external device manufacturing, and device distribution. How you will make an impact: Support design assurance and development activities (i.e., requirement development, risk assessment, engineering study, feasibility testing, drawing review, etc.) for New Product Development program Participate in test method development/validation activities for New Product Development programs. Collaborate with the R&D and Sustaining organizations to help facilitate the successful execution of the NPD process and launching of robust products Develop experiments and tests (including writing and executing protocols) to create, validate, and improve products and manufacturing processes/methods based on engineering principles; analyze results, make recommendations, and develop reports. Investigate complaints from clinical cases, which may include: - Reviewing customer experience reports to determine potential device contribution - Hands-on evaluation of product returned from the field - Assess against risk management documentation, updating as necessary Support product release processes, including disposition of product and material quality control. Develop, update, and maintain technical content of risk management files (e.g. FMEAs, Quality Control Plans).. Develop training and documentation materials for production (e.g., work instructions) to enable the seamless knowledge transfer of project and manufacturing processes Implement and approve compliant change control. Support to external and internal audits. Assign support tasks; gives instruction to technicians on conducting tests; trains technicians and provides feedback; and may coordinate technician work.
